We can fly from here was released on the "The Word is Live" 3-disc compilation, and is recorded on various bootlegs of the Drama tour. It and "Go Through This" were both tracks that didn't make it onto the disc due to the deadline, but they made it onto the tour. An instrumental version of Go Through This called "Have we really got to go through this?" was one of the bonus tracks on the Rhino remaster of Drama. Both are good tracks. I believe "Go Through This" is also on The Word Is Live.
That being said, I hope neither find their way onto this "new" album. They were good tracks, but now, 30 years later, I hope they have something better to say than either of those. Edited by TheGazzardian - March 09 2011 at 15:28 |
